PEP vs PG: Which Is the Better Dividend Stock?

As of August 2026, PEP (PepsiCo, Inc.) screens as the stronger dividend stock, winning 5 of 8 head-to-head metrics. PEP offers the higher yield at 4.26%, PG has the higher dividend-safety score, and PEP trades at the larger discount to fair value (-5%).

MetricPEPPG
Forward yield4.26%3.00%
Annual dividend$5.92$4.35
Payout ratio75%64%
Years of growth53 yr42 yr
5-yr dividend growth6.9%6.0%
5-yr total return-11%1%
Dividend safety score81 (A)90 (A)
Fair value estimate$132.01$133.08
Upside to fair value-5%-8%
Frequencyquarterlyquarterly
Market cap$189.6B$341.2B
P/E ratio18.222.4
